Keyless entry
A lot of the aspects of owning a car have been simplified by keyless entry. The convenience of unlocking your car without touching a handle or even needing to turn a key in the ignition is an appealing feature for many consumers and drivers. While there are some doubts about security, it's crucial to understand the mechanism behind this technology and how you can protect it from theft.
The remote keyless entry system in your car is built on radio signals sent out by the car's onboard computer. The computer onboard the car scans for these radio signals and, when it finds them, sends its own signal to any key fobs that are within distance. The fob has a small transponder that is designed to respond to these frequencies. The response is a digital code which informs the receiver precisely what to do. If the response matches what the receiver would expect, it will fulfill the task.
To program the key fob, you'll have to put the car in a specific mode. This is accomplished by turning the key on and off eight times over the span of a few minutes or following the same process. When the car is in programming mode, one or more of the fob buttons need to be pressed. One of these buttons will transmit a digital identification code that will be stored by the onboard computer. This will enable the vehicle to recognize the key fob as a transmitter that has been authorized by the manufacturer.

The remote keyless entry system keeps drivers from locking their vehicles using keys inside. This is done by installing special antennas on the outside of your vehicle to determine whether keys are inside or outside the cabin. This will stop people from entering the vehicle to start the engine when you are refueling the vehicle or removing something from the trunk.

Open and close the power liftgate
Power liftgate opens and closes is a convenient feature that lets you operate the rear door of your car remotely. The power liftgate can be operated with a push button on your key fob, or a switch inside your vehicle. There are several different systems available with one of them being one that can be opened without hands with the swipe of a hand. The system can be programmed to stop if it detects a blockage. It is an ideal option for those who have physical limitations, since it allows easy access to the cargo area without having users to bend or reach over the tailgate.
A lot of newer cars have this feature as standard equipment. If your vehicle doesn't have this feature, you might be able to install it later on. The system is easy to install and can be fitted on any vehicle with doors in the rear that open using a hinge-lok mechanism. It only requires the use of a few components, and is able to be installed on vehicles that fall in the mainstream and luxury segments.
The power liftgate system is powered by a battery. The two principal switches of the system are situated on the overhead console and the D-pillar. They send a signal via the Controller Area Network Data Bus circuit to the control module if activated. The control module interprets the signal and confirms that safety requirements have been fulfilled prior to applying the motor with power. The power liftgate also has a sensor that prevents it from closing if it detects an object.
A power liftgate that doesn't close properly may be caused by a defective switch. You can test for this by inspecting the switch's electrical connector for indications of damage. Additionally, you can test the fuses that control the power liftgate inside the fuse box under the instrument panel. You can replace the switch or fuse in case they are blown.

Remote start
Remote start is an option that shines in tough circumstances. You can remotely start your vehicle to warm or cool it before you enter. When you're ready to go your car is at the temperature you want it to be.
Before you purchase or install remote start for your car it is crucial to understand how it works. It is more complex than you think and can be dangerous if not properly done. For maximum safety and reliability it is best to have professionals manage the installation.
Remote starter systems bypass the vehicle's immobilizer that is designed to prevent the engine from being started without the correct key. The system uses a special module that is programmed to communicate through the car's two-way data port to the internal computer. This is how it receives commands from the smartphone or remote fob, and passes control back to you once you're near enough to enter your vehicle.
Besides starting the car, some systems also allow you to lock and unlock doors, open the trunk, and even warm up or cool down the seats. Some systems can even monitor fuel levels and send notifications directly to your phone. While these are great benefits, it's important to remember that a prolonged idle of your vehicle could result in negative effects on fuel economy and long-term health of the engine.
